Download file from server jsf tutorial

If specified, the jsf library or libraries included in the module dependencies. It is a serverside java framework for web development. Javaserver faces technology is a serverside user interface component framework for java technologybased web applications. Jsf primefaces hello world example using wildfly and maven 7 minute read primefaces is an open source component library for javaserver faces jsf. Java server faces jsf is a popular web application framework for java. In this tutorial we will create and execute a web application using the jsf facelets technology. How to provide a file download from a jsf backing bean.

Now that you have gained some insights on servlets, lets move ahead and understand what is java server pages. Filedownload is used by attaching it to any jsf command component. Here we are going to read and write a file using jsp. Click on new runtime button next to target runtime drop down list and add tomcat 7 as follows. Example of downloading file from the server using jsp. Download file from server using react roy tutorials. Go through the following steps for creating react project to download file from server using react. Since i have written a lot about java servlet recently, i thought to provide a sample example of servlet file upload to server and then download from server to client. Create a jsf project in eclipse oxygen, add mojarra libraries manually, edit web. Java server faces jsf technology is a front end framework which makes the creation of user interface components easier by reusing the ui components.

In this tutorial, let us see how to upload files from client to server with the use of jsf h. If you want to get a book, i highly recommend the jsf. After the streams are closed there is one important thing to do. Go through the link creating angular project to create a new project. In eclipse, windowshow viewservers if you have a working tomcat in eclipse, go to step 6. I will demystify jsf and help you understand the essential concepts to get started with jsf web application development. Downloading file from the server in jsp javatpoint. Jsf primefaces hello world example using websphere. Servlet and jsp tutorial how to build web applications. Creating javaserver faces application in eclipse february 26.

It is an extension to servlet as it provides more functionality than a. Filedownload is used to stream binary contents like files stored in database to the client. Go through the following steps for creating angular project to download file from server using angular. Hello all, in this tutorial we are going to learn to create a hello world jsf 2 application in eclipse. Jsf i about the tutorial java server faces jsf is a javabased web application framework intended to simplify development integration of webbased user interfaces. Creating jsf application in eclipse java web tutor. Part instance which is behind the scenes temporarily stored in servers memory andor temporary disk storage location which you. In this tutorial, i will help you quickly get up to speed with jsf. Jsp or java server pages is a technology that is used to create web application just like servlet technology. Download file from server using angular 78 roy tutorials.

Free pdf tutorial about the basics of jsf and eclipse,training document for beginners under 28 pages to learn how to install and setup jsf. Java project tutorial make login and register form step by step using netbeans and mysql database duration. Jsf primefaces hello world example using websphere application server and maven 8 minute read ibm websphere application server was is a software framework and middleware developed by international business machines corporation. Download and unzip tomcat 9 anywhere on your computer. Download jsf tutorial in pdf download computer tutorials. Javaserver faces jsf is part of the java platform, enterprise edition, that is used for building componentbased user interfaces for web applications. A simple example of creating a downloadable file and serving it from a java servlet application. This works fine, but when i have downloaded the file, i find that when i click on any action component on the portal jsf page, it just refreshes the page instead of performing the action. In the next step, you will create a workshopjsftutorial project from the sample web application which contains support files. It is the standard web application framework for java ee. Example of downloading file from the server in servlet.

Make sure you give the project name as angularfiledownload. Jsf is designed based on the model view controller pattern mvc which segregates the presentation, controller and the business logic. Select java server faces from the list of frameworks, then in the libraries tab under the java server faces configuration, select jsf 2. But if there is any java file or jsp file etc, you need to create a program to download that file. In eclipse ide, go to file new dynamic web project.

This tutorial will give you a great starting point for building any web application using java server, faces, and bootstrap. Jsf java server faces tutorials beginners tutorial for. Java server faces jsf is a javabased web application framework intended to simplify development integration of webbased user interfaces. It is designed to significantly ease the burden of writing and maintaining applications that run on a java application server and render their uis back to a target client. Pdf bytes are being read in the while loop and written to the response outputstream.

Lets start learning about the downloading the files from remote server by using java server pages jsp. In this article i will show you how to create a simple javaserver faces jsf web application starting from zero with eclipse and maven. Find out more features on jsf tooling in our jsf tools reference guide. In this tutorial we will explain you how to install jsf 1.

It can be a text file, binary file, image file or any other document. When i was setting up a fresh install of javaee on my laptop today, the jsf download library would not return any results to download. Take advantage of this course called introduction to java server page jsf to improve your programming skills and better understand jsf this course is adapted to your level as well as all jsf pdf courses to better enrich your knowledge all you need to do is download the training document, open it and start learning jsf for free this tutorial has been prepared for the beginners to help. Java server faces jsf tutorial provides complete jsf 1. We will develop small web application to test our integrated environment. Javaserver faces is a standardized display technology, which was formalized in a specification through the java community process. It hosts javabased web applications and is built using open standards such as java ee, xml, and web services. Servlet upload file and download file example journaldev. Make sure you give the project name as angular file download. It provides coverage of key jsf concepts such as user interfaceui components, renderers, backing beans, validators, converters, navigation, event handling, expession language, messages etc.

Facelets is an extension to javaserver facesjsf that uses xhtml syntax to define a jsf page. If there is any jar or zip file, you can direct provide a link to that file. Here in case of file uploading, only post method will be. I’ve also provided a quick description of each section in the tutorial series. Free unaffiliated ebook created from stack overflow contributor. Example of downloading file from the server in servlet javatpoint. Javaserver faces jsf is a user interface ui framework for java web applications.

Using the resources and steps described in this tutorial, you will learn how. Since i have written a lot about java servlet recently, i thought to provide a sample example of servlet file upload to server and then download from server to. In summary, with this tutorial you should now know how to organize jsf sample application using the wizards provided by jboss tools, configure its stuff and finally run it on the jboss server. Jsf tutorials at rose india covers everything you need to know about jsf.

A simple jsf tutorial with primefaces and json object parsing in java updated jan 18. In this tutorial, jsf is used to create a simple greeting web application to run on the tomcat server. If this is a new eclipse and no tomcat is already in the servers tab window, right click on that window. Complete java server faces jsf tutorial jsf tutorials. For doing this, we have to write two files one for giving the link of the file to be downloaded and other one of jsp in which we will code for downloading the file. See chapters 9 through of the java ee tutorial for tutorial documentation on javaserver faces technology 1. Wtp tutorials javaserver faces tools tutorial summary.

Our jsf tutorial includes all topics of jsf such as features, example, validation, bean validation, managed bean, referencing. Servlet upload file and download file is a common task in java web application. It provides a collection of mostly visual components widgets that can be used by jsf programmers to build the ui for a web application. In this tutorial, let us see how to create a simple hello world web application using jsf 2. Jsf tutorial provides basic and advanced concepts of jsf.

Next pdf file bytes are being read the same way we have shown you in the java download file tutorial some time ago. First jsf tutorial with eclipse neon, tomcat 9 connected web. Tutorial jsf in pdf download free jsf tutorial course in pdf, training file in 6 chapters and 18 pages. This java tutorial describes the steps to write code for a java servlet that transfers a file from the server to the client web browser. So there is no need to write the program to download. Creating jsf application by using eclipse and maven java. A save as file dialog opens up with the jsf portal page in the background. Javaserver faces jsf is a ui component based java web application framework. The jsf facelets tools project is a wtp incubator project that has provided features that simplifies building web applications using facelets. In case youre using icefaces, then you need to nest a in the command component. For downloading a file from the server, here is the simple example. Jsf inputfile fileupload example the jsf inputfile component is used to upload files from client machine.

Our jsf tutorial is designed for beginners and professionals both. If its located outside the public webcontent for some specific reasons e. Prepare for jsf application development help intellij idea. Jsf primefaces hello world example using wildfly and.

1028 1012 674 14 394 106 752 109 412 548 59 1093 1323 1009 192 103 928 1244 661 795 1223 84 1177 378 481 373 916 1454 1225 767 485 652 1548 639 295 1184 1200 997 4 621 25 72 1087 88 187 354 1276 532 783 28